Construction Assistant Project Manager - Manhattan, New York
Join a family-owned construction firm specializing in high-end commercial interiors in Manhattan. This role offers exposure to prestigious clients and a chance to work on diverse, well-designed projects.
Client Details
A smaller, tight-knit general contractor known for its expertise in healthcare, hotels, offices, and educational spaces. The company prides itself on employee retention and a strong reputation with top developers like Cushman & Wakefield, SL Green, and China Construction.
Description
Assist Project Managers in planning, scheduling, and execution.
Coordinate with subcontractors, vendors, and site teams.
Track budgets, submittals, and RFIs.
Ensure quality control and adherence to project timelines.
Support in client and stakeholder communications.
Profile
Detail-oriented and highly organized.
Strong communicator with problem-solving abilities.
Eager to grow within a reputable company.
Comfortable working in a fast-paced, high-end construction environment.
Job Offer
Salary range: $70,000 - $90,000.
Competitive benefits package.
Opportunity to work on prestigious NYC projects.
Strong career growth potential in a stable, growing company.
